- ベストアンサー
XWindowって何ですか?
- みんなの回答 (8)
- 専門家の回答
質問者が選んだベストアンサー
No.4です。 質問にありました件ですが、No.3はUNIXサーバ側のシステム(GUI=Graphic User Interface、グラフイックユーザーインターフェリス)についての説明で、No.1はそのシステムをリモートから利用する立場から、サーバのグラフィックコンソールをリモート端末にXシステムのコンソールをソックリ手元の端末に表示させる「XシステムのWindows(複数のウィンドウ)」のことをX-Windowsということですね。 同じシステムをサーバだけについて言及したのがNo.3、X のサーバをGUI環境で利用するための接続や操作端末の立場から説明したのがNo.1といえます。 最近は大抵のLINUXパソコンもGUI環境を持ち、サーバとして使えますので、後はグラフィックを伴うアプリケーションを整備すれば、X-Windowsのサーバ/Xエミュレーション端末環境が整うわけですね。 X-Windowsの端末となりうるのはLinuxなどのUNIX系パソコンのほか、Xエミュレーションソフトを搭載したWindows端末およびMacOS端末ですね。 UNIXによるXのGUI環境で接続しないサーバとクライアント、つまり、単なるサーバとクライアントの接続や他のコンピューターの画面をリモートで操作するだけの接続は、X-Window(s)システムとが言いません。
その他の回答 (7)
- Lean
- ベストアンサー率72% (435/603)
No.3(No.6)です。 お気を悪くしたら済みません。 No.7でお書きになった事、つまり -------8<-------8<-------8<-------8<-------8<------- 2)LinuxのXtemウインドウからアプリケーションサーバにログインした端末ウインドウ 上の操作になります。 UNIXサーバ(No.4のgipwckに相当)側の操作は2)のウインドウで操作します。 つまり、「setenv DISPLAY ...」とアプリケーション(SAS,Matlab,GaussView,Ansys,Phoenicsなど)の起動ですね。 -------8<-------8<-------8<-------8<-------8<------- という事が、No.4の内容だけで分かりますか? そういう事がNo.4の内容だけでは分からないので、あえて間違いと書かさせて頂きました。 ただ、No.7でその部分を補足していらっしゃるので、これ以上どうこう言うつもりはありません。
- info22
- ベストアンサー率55% (2225/4034)
No4の補足です。 No.6さん回答の以下の部分は実際に操作しアプリケーションを起動させた手順ですので間違ってはいません。 >あと、No.4にある手順は、(間違っていますが) サーバ側の操作もLinux上からサーバにログインして行いますので、よく読んでいただかないといけないですね。 以降は問題ありません。 >No.4でいう所のUNIXサーバ上にあるXアプリケーションを実行しその実行画面をLinux端末に表示させる手順です。 すべて、Linux端末から端末ウインドウを2つ開いて行います。 1)Linuxの端末ウインドウ(Xtermウインドウ) と 2)LinuxのXtemウインドウからアプリケーションサーバにログインした端末ウインドウ 上の操作になります。 UNIXサーバ(No.4のgipwckに相当)側の操作は2)のウインドウで操作します。 つまり、「setenv DISPLAY ...」とアプリケーション(SAS,Matlab,GaussView,Ansys,Phoenicsなど)の起動ですね。 1)(No2のuserpcを操作する)ウインドウではXサーバをUNIXサーバに対して開く操作(xhost +)とアプリケーション終了時サーバを閉じる操作(xhost -)をします。
- Lean
- ベストアンサー率72% (435/603)
No.3です。 X Window Systemの動作原理について参考URLを参考にしてみてください。 Xの世界では、No.4の方がお書きになった例で行くと、Linux端末側(画面表示を行う方)がXのサーバ、UNIXサーバ側(アプリケーションを起動している方)がXのクライアントになります。 一般のサーバクライアントと比べて、ユーザ側がサーバになります。 No.1でお書きになっているX端末は、XにそもそもあるXDMCP(X Display Manager Control Protocol)を使用してXが動作しているホストのX端末になっています。 あと、No.4にある手順は、(間違っていますが)No.4でいう所のUNIXサーバ上にあるXアプリケーションを実行しその実行画面をLinux端末に表示させる手順です。
お礼
ありがとうございます。
- info22
- ベストアンサー率55% (2225/4034)
No.1です。 X-Window(S)は以下のようにUNIXサーバに接続します。 Linux端末の操作 1) % xhost +gipwck 2) % (実行コマンド) & 3) % xhost -gipwck 実行コマンドはサーバにインストールされているアプリケーションソフトの実行コマンドです。 UNIXサーバ側の操作 % setenv DISPLAY userpc[.domain.ac.jp]:0.0 userpcはLinux端末のホスト名です。 このコマンドはUNIXサーバにtelnetでログインして実行してやります。するとLINUX端末のディスプレイにUNIXサーバのログイン起動画面が表示されますので、UNIXサーバ本体の前で操作するように、LINUX端末でUNIXサーバが操作できるようになります。 上記の「2) % (実行コマンド) &」は、LINUX端末から入力するUNIXサーバ上のコマンドになります。
補足
No.3さんが言ってるX window systemとNo.1さんが説明してくれたXwindowとは別物なんですか?よかったら教えてくださいm(__)m
- Lean
- ベストアンサー率72% (435/603)
XWindowと書いていらっしゃるものが、X Window Systemの事を指すなら元々UNIX系OSにGUI環境を構築するためのコマンド群やXlibやX Toolkitと言ったGUIのプログラムを作成するためのライブラリ群その他の総称です。 ちなみにX Window Systemの事をXWindowとかXWindowsとか書いているのを見かけますが、それは間違いです。 X Window Systemのリファレンスマニュアルにも書かれていますが、X Window Systemの名前を書く場合には「X」、「X Window System」、「X Version 11」、「X Window System, Version 11」、「X11」のどれかを使用して欲しいとしています。 Windowsも昔はMS-DOS上で動作していた時がありましたが、その時のMS-DOSとWindwosとの関係とUNIX系OSとXの関係が同じです。 つまり、OS上で動作するGUI環境を提供するWindowシステムアプリケーションと言う事になるわけです。 >Windowsでいうコマンドプロンプトみたいなもんですか(--;)? Xで言うと端末エミュレータが該当しますね。 なお、そのXWindowがX Window Systemとは別物のソフトな場合、上記の説明は当てはまりません。
お礼
参考になりました。ありがとうございます。
- neKo_deux
- ベストアンサー率44% (5541/12319)
> Windowsでいうコマンドプロンプトみたいなもんですか(--;)? 昔のWindows3.1だと、 Linuxのカーネル→DOS Windows→X-Window かな? IT用語辞典 e-Words : X Window Systemとは 【Xウィンドウ・システム】 ─ 意味・解説 http://e-words.jp/w/X20Window20System.html 最近のパッケージ版のLunux製品だとインストールするとマウスで操作できるGUI環境まで自動的に入るので意識しにくいですが、本来ならコマンドラインでオペレーティングを行うCUI環境が基本です。 http://e-words.jp/w/motif.html
お礼
ありがとうございます。お手数かけましたm(__)m
- info22
- ベストアンサー率55% (2225/4034)
昔UNIXのワークステーションの画面をX端末という端末にそっくり持ってきて、リモートでUNIXワークステーションを利用する形態がありました。現在のLinuxでは標準でX端末のエミュレーション機能(仮想端末機能)が標準で装備されています。つまり、XWindow(s)機能を使えば、遠隔のUNIXを、そのデスクトップ画面を自分のLINUXの画面にそのまま表示させて操作できるようになります。 つまり遠隔のUNIX計算機のコンソール画面を自分のパソコンの画面にそっくり表示させリモートで遠隔UNIX計算機を操作できる機能で、当然リモートのUNIX機にログインしてUNIXを使えるということです。
お礼
ありがとうございました。
関連するQ&A
- Tiny Core Linux の xWindow に戻るには,どうす
Tiny Core Linux の xWindow に戻るには,どうすればよいのでしょうか? 終了の画面で,間違ってコマンドプロンプトに出てしまった後,xWindow に 戻るコマンドどれでしょうか?
- ベストアンサー
- その他(ソフトウェア)
- RedHat8.0のXWINDOWでのインストール
度々ここをお世話なっております。 今回はLINUXを入れまして、XWINDOWでいろいろ いじろうかと思いました。TEXTモードならインストール の仕方は分かりますが、XWINDOWで簡単にインストール (WINDOWSみたいなインストーラー)はございませんで しょうか?もしあったのなら教えてくださいませ。
- ベストアンサー
- その他(OS)
- Xwindowが表示されません
Turbolinux7 Workstation FTP版のインストールについてお聞きします。 上記をインストールしたのですが、Xwindowが表示されません。 ******************************************************************* PCはAptiva J3Aです。WindowsのEドライブに2G残っているところに、Linux用に 約1.6Gと、スワップ用に64Mを設定して、ループバックインストールをしました。 途中Xの設定で、ビデオカードは自動認識できていたようです。デスクトップの設定では 65536色と1024x768でしたが、「この設定をテストする」を押すと、 正しく表示されなかったので、800x600に設定して、再度テストを押すと、 デスクトップ画面が正しく表示されました。以後は、順調にいって、再起動しました。 Rootでログインした後、コマンドラインでstartxとしたのですが、画面表示が変に 表示された後、全面灰色(の小さい模様)になり、X(のマウスカーソル)が表示されます。 このカーソルをクリックすると10個ぐらいのメニューが表示されます。どれを押しても 反応がなく、Xterm と Exitのみが反応します。結局Exitで元のコマンドラインに 戻るしかありません。 *************************************************************** 画面設定が間違っているのでしょうか?Turboxcfgで、もう一度上記設定を行ったのですが 結局、Xwindowは表示されませんでした。 私、Linux歴2週間の超初心者です。詳しくお教え下さい。
- ベストアンサー
- その他(OS)
- Xwindowの設定
TurboLinuxをインストールしたのですがXwindowの設定がどうしてもうまく行きません。startxのコマンドを使うと When reporting a problem related to a sever crash,please send the full sever output,not just the last messages. なんていうメッセージが最後に出てきます。上の方には unable to open /deve/agpgart:no such drive Fatal sever error:Aborting なんて出てくるのですが全く分かりません。 一応、グラフィックカードは読みこんでいるのですがその設定がおかしいのでしょうか? それともこのパソコンではLinuxはXwindowは使えないのでしょうか? ちなみに使用しているパソコンはiiyamaでチップセットは Intel corporatin 82810 cgc chipset graphics と出ていたのですが・・・。
- ベストアンサー
- その他(OS)
- Xwindowが使えません
OSはLinux6.2です。 startxとすると一瞬真っ黒になってから Symbol VBEInit from module /usr/X11R6/lib/modules/driver/i810_drv.ois unresolved! Symbol vbeDoEDID from module /usr/X11R6/lib/modules/driver/i810_drv.ois unresolved! Fatal server error Addscreen/ScreenInit faild driver 0 と表示されxwindowが使用できません。 使えるようにするにはどのようにしたらいいでしょうか 宜しくお願いします。
- ベストアンサー
- その他(OS)
- red hat linuxでxwindowが表示されません。
red hat linux 7.3をインストールしたのですがxwindowが立ち上がらずコマンド入力モード(ログインはできます)になってしまいます。おそらくビデオチップがIntel 845G内蔵3Dと新しいためかと友人が言っていました。このような場合何をどうすればよいのでしょうか。linux始めたばかりなもので迷っています。 ちなみにPCはエプソンダイレクトでオーダーメイドしたMT6100でインストールの際raidを組んでいます。
- 締切済み
- その他(OS)
- Xwindowについて part2
以前にも質問させていただいたのですが、linuxをinstallしようとしたところ、モニターの設定でうまくいきません。どううまくいかにかというと、モニターが自動認識されないので、周波数を合わせ、『Generic』で色々選択し『この設定をテストする』ボタンで試してみたのですが、その度に画面が真っ暗になり、どうやらマングース自体がフリーズしているようなのです。 使用しているパソコンは、日立のPRIUS.570B5SWで、使用用途はC/C++やwindowsでいうOFFICEのようなものを使いたいと思っています。 Xwindowをインストールしないとこのような用途でつかうのは無理でしょうか?
- ベストアンサー
- その他(OS)
- windowsコマンドプロンプトにて。
windowsコマンドプロンプトについての質問なんですが。 自分は今、学生でLinux(OS)を主に使っていて、JAVAを勉強中です。 それで、Linuxではviコマンドでなんとかファイル編集などが容易にできるのですが、コマンドプロンプトの場合は、mdとechoを使ってファイル作成をするだけで、どうやって編集すればいいのかわかりません。 なので、編集できるコマンド!又は方法を知ってる方は教えてください。 JAVA環境は整えました。
- 締切済み
- Java
- vmware serverにはXwindowは必須?
linuxにvmware serverをインストールしようとしていますが、その際Xwindowは必ずインストールしなければならないものなのでしょうか? ちなみにX無しでインストールしwindows上のVMware Server Consoleから接続しインストールしようとすると、Unknown error: 0x80040102と出てisoイメージがマウント出来ません。 お分かりなる方教えてください。よろしくお願いします。
- ベストアンサー
- Linux系OS
- Xwindowが急に駄目になりました
皆さんこんにちわ。 Linuxを開始間もない素人ですが、 急にXwindowが利用できなくなり、 前回の終わり方が悪かったのか?と思ったり、 方策を自分なりに考え、試したのですが解決に至らず ご相談させていただくに至りました。 アドバイスなどいただけますとありがたい次第です。 X-windowが使えるようになるためにサーバの設定を行い、 昨日まで使用していたのでが、 本日より急に使えなくなってしまいました。 使えなくなったというのは、 具体的にいいますと、 いつもは以下の通りstartxをコマンド入力すると、 Xwindowが起動されていたのですが、 # startx 本日は、何回やってみてもエラーが表示されてしまいます。 disable montype:1 finished PLL2 finish PLL1 Entering Restore TV Restore TVHV Restore TV Restarts Restore Timing Tables Resore TV standard Leaving Restore TV giving up xinit: Connection refused(errno 111):unable to connect to X server xinit: No such process(errno 3): Server error 再設定をすればいいのかな?とも思い、 root権限にて以下の通り実行してみたのですが、 Xconfiguratorが見つからない始末であります。 # Xconfiguretor -bash: Xconfigurator : command not found OSはFedora9を利用しております。
- ベストアンサー
- Linux系OS
お礼
何度もお答えいただきありがとうございました。あと、お礼が遅くなり申し訳ありませんでした。もっと勉強してみます。